Java教程

group by用法

本文主要是介绍group by用法,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
Group by 用法

Group by 是一种常见的数据分组和聚合方法,用于分析数据并按照特定属性进行分组。在 IT 领域和 IT 世界中,Group by 用法广泛应用于数据分析、数据挖掘和商业智能等领域。本文将对 Group by 用法进行简要解读和分析,以帮助读者更好地理解和应用这一方法。

按照特定属性对数据进行分组的方法

Group by 是一种按照特定属性对数据进行分组的方法,它可以根据需要将数据按照多种属性进行分组,如时间、地区、性别等。通过 Group by,用户可以更好地了解不同属性之间的关系,以及各个属性对数据的影响。

举个例子,一家电商网站,用户可以通过 Group by 按照商品类型(如家居、服饰、鞋帽等)将商品数据进行分组,进一步了解各个商品类别的销售情况。这样,用户就可以针对不同商品类别进行优化和调整,提高销售效率。

数据聚合

Group by 还可以用于数据聚合。例如,在一家酒店的数据分析中,用户可以通过 Group by 将客人类型(如商务、休闲、家庭等)作为分组依据,对不同客人类型的住宿偏好、消费水平等数据进行汇总和统计。这样,用户就可以更好地了解不同客人类型的住宿需求和市场趋势,为酒店的运营和决策提供有力支持。

局限性

Group by 也存在一些局限性。首先,由于 Group by 方法过于依赖分组粒度,可能会导致数据过于细分。其次,在某些场景下,Group by 的效果可能并不明显,如数据分布较为均匀,或者分组粒度过大等。

总结

在实际应用中,用户需要根据具体场景和需求来选择合适的分组方式。同时,Group by 在 IT 领域和 IT 世界中的发展也在不断推进,未来将有望成为数据分析领域的重要技术手段。

这篇关于group by用法的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!